A police officer serving at Hotoro Division in Kano has been shot dead during clashes between rival gangs. Sani S.O. was killed just weeks before he would have retired after more than 30 years on the force.

He was deployed with colleagues to stop fighting between two groups of thugs when gunfire broke out. One of the gangs allegedly had a dane gun and opened fire on the officer.

According to someone who knew him, the officer was rushed to hospital but died from his injuries. The source, who asked not to be named, described him as a respected community figure.

"He was a good person who contributed greatly to society," the source told Daily Trust. "He was weeks away from retirement when this happened."

Police authorities have not yet commented on the incident. Calls and text messages to state police spokesperson CSP Abdullahi Haruna Kiyawa went unanswered at press time.

Kano has seen a spike in gang violence recently across multiple neighborhoods. Areas like Fagge, Abattoir Market, Koki, Kurnar Asabe, Hotoro and Gyadi-Gyadi have all been affected in recent weeks.

Some districts hadn't experienced such clashes before this resurgence. Security officials worry the trend could worsen as Nigeria approaches the 2027 general elections.

Gang violence typically increases during election seasons in Nigeria. Political tensions and electoral campaigns often fuel such activities in major cities.
